Deep Dive

1. High Selling Pressure & Volume Surge

Overview: The 24-hour trading volume exploded by 225.98% to $46.67 million amidst the price decline. This high volume confirms aggressive selling, as the turnover ratio of 3.29 indicates the market is highly liquid but dominated by sellers. What it means: Such a volume spike during a drop often signals capitulation or large holders (whales) distributing their tokens, putting intense downward pressure on price.

2. Broader Market Dip & Altcoin Weakness

Overview: The move occurred within a risk-off session where the total crypto market cap fell 1.86% and Bitcoin dropped 2%. News feeds highlighted institutional flow concerns and "risk-off" sentiment (@datamaxiplus). Concurrently, the Altcoin Season Index fell 7.5% to 37, signaling capital rotation away from altcoins. What it means: NEWT's severe underperformance suggests it is a higher-beta asset suffering disproportionately during a market-wide pullback and sector outflow.
